A rare earth magnet 1, or a method of making a rare earth magnet, comprises : depositing dysprosium 3 onto only one or more particular parts of the surface of a rare earth magnet body 2. The dysprosium 3 may be deposited by a cold spray process which provides one or more beads onto particular surface locations of a sintered rare earth alloy body 2 with a grain structure 5. The sprayed magnet may be subjected to a heat treatment which induces a grain boundary diffusion process for the dysprosium to form shell layers 6 around one or more grains. The magnet 1 may include a neodymium alloy, such as Nd2Fe14B. The magnet 1 may make efficient use of the dysprosium material.
